SU rebuild problem... 444-544

I finally got around to rebuilding the dual SUs (HS6) I picked up for my 544. I removed the Weber Kit and wanted to go back to the SUs. Anyway, there seems to be a problem with the front carb...the piston sticks. If I put the dashpot on I can't get it to lift easily, just about have to pry it up. The rear carb seems fine. I have interchanged 2 other pistons into the carb and still the sticking problem. It unsticks and moves freely if I open the throttle. Any ideas on this? I do have a set of HS4 SUs...but I do a fair amount of HWY driving and thought the HS6s would handle it better (mileage & power). Am I wrong in this assumption?
